PLC编程详解:顺序延时接通程序与指令系统
需积分: 45 186 浏览量
更新于2024-08-22
收藏 4.67MB PPT 举报
“顺序延时接通程序-PLC相关的资料”
在PLC编程中,顺序延时接通程序是一种常见的控制逻辑,它涉及到输入信号的处理、定时器的应用以及输出的有序控制。在这个例子中,当输入端X0被激活(接通)后,输出端Y0、Y1、Y2会按照设定的时间间隔依次接通,每个间隔为10秒。当X0断开时,所有输出将同时停止。这个程序主要利用了PLC的定时器功能和逻辑控制指令。
PLC(Programmable Logic Controller)的主要编程语言包括梯形图、指令表、顺序功能图、功能块图和结构文本。其中,梯形图因其形象直观且电气工程师易于理解的特点,成为最常用的语言形式。梯形图编程类似于传统的继电器控制电路,但简化了符号,使得编程更为便捷。
在梯形图编程中,遵循一定的规则是至关重要的。首先,逻辑行的绘制应遵循从左到右(串联)和自上而下的(并联)顺序。每行始于左母线,通过触点和线圈,最终终止于右母线。每个逻辑行必须以继电器线圈结束,且线圈与右母线之间不允许有触点。触点串联块并联时,为了节省存储空间,通常将触点多的块放置在上方。此外,输出线圈不能直接连接到输入继电器IR或特殊继电器SR。
针对三菱FX2N系列PLC,其指令系统包括基本指令、步进指令和功能指令。基本指令包括逻辑控制和顺序控制,如LD(取)和OR(或)等,它们在编程器上有对应的输入键。步进指令用于顺序控制,而功能指令则更为复杂,需要通过功能键输入,如FUN(01)来指定功能号。
指令由两部分组成:操作码和操作数。操作码用助记符表示,如“LD”表示取操作,“OUT”表示驱动输出线圈。操作数则定义操作的对象,可以是编程元件的地址,如输入X000或输出Y000。标识符(如X、Y、M等)代表元件类型,参数则给出具体地址或设定值。
例如,指令“LD X000”表示从输入X000读取数据,而“OUT Y000”则驱动输出线圈Y000。在顺序延时接通程序中,可能需要使用定时器指令(如T0、T1、T2)来设置不同时间间隔,确保Y0、Y1、Y2按顺序接通和关闭。
总结来说,顺序延时接通程序是通过梯形图编程实现的,它利用PLC的基本指令、定时器和逻辑控制,确保在特定时间间隔内输出的有序切换。对于三菱FX2N系列PLC,理解其指令系统和编程规则是编写此类程序的关键。
2020-08-09 上传
2015-01-01 上传
2022-11-16 上传
2023-03-08 上传
2024-10-30 上传
2024-10-30 上传
2024-09-30 上传
2023-12-08 上传
2023-03-27 上传
受尽冷风
- 粉丝: 29
- 资源: 2万+
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践